WitrynaThe porphyrias are a group of metabolic disorders, each caused by impairment of one of the enzymes in the heme biosynthetic pathway (Figure 1). In affected people, buildup of specific pathway intermediates (porphyrins and porphyrin precursors) causes characteristic signs and symptoms. Most porphyrias are inherited disorders (Table 1).
